IN a successful endeavor organized by Mayor Rolando "Klarex" Uy's office, today proved to be a fortunate day for 431 workers and their families in Barangay Carmen, Cagayan de Oro City. 

City Mayor's Office Chief of Staff Shiela Lumbatan expressed this sentiment, emphasizing the significance of the assistance provided to the deserving individuals, particularly the displaced workers and and individuals earning low wages.

The event, called TUPAD pay-out, was made possible through the coordination efforts of Mayor Uy and  DUMPER PTDA Partylist Representative Claudine Bautista.

The TUPAD pay-out initiative aimed to provide aid to displaced workers, drivers, riders, and individuals earning below the minimum wage. 

Mayor Rolando "Klarex" Uy and DUMPER Partylist Rep. Claudine Bautista enable TUPAD Pay-out for displaced workers. (Photo supplied)

"The generous contribution of DUMPER PTDA Partylist Rep. Bautista made this assistance possible," ssid Lumbatan. 

She said the event took place earlier Thursday at the Carmen National High School Covered Court.

Each recipient was fortunate to receive a total of P4,050 to support their daily expenses, acvording to Lumbatan.
